Canadian Prime Minister Mark Carney and President Trump are planning further talks after holding a “productive call” but failing to clinch a trade deal, the WSJ reports. “We expect the Canadian dollar to remain under pressure in the near-term as the trade deal with the U.S. remains the main risk on the horizon,” TD Securities strategists say in a note. Meanwhile, Canada’s lower-than-expected July inflation data earlier this week boosted expectations for another rate cut by year-end.
